#d22bdc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d22bdc is composed of 82.4% red, 16.9%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.5%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 296.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 51.6%. #d22bdc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#a500b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d22bdc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d22bdc has RGB values of R:210, G:43,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 13773788.

Shades and Tints of #d22bdc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070107 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d22bdc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868187 is the less saturated color, while #eb0ff9 is the most saturated one.
